What is the most complex attribute to understand when evaluating a smart pressure switch and a pump starter, and how should you interpret it?
The most complex attribute is the pressure control range, including how the switch activates and stops the pump. Look for models with adjustable or clearly indicated cut-in and cut-out pressures and a readable gauge to set them accurately. This setting balances water demand with pump protection and energy use across tasks. Confirm compatibility with your pump’s flow and head requirements before purchase.

How do I mount and maintain a smart pressure switch and pump starter to ensure longevity?
Mount the controller close to the pump in a dry, accessible location and secure all electrical connections. Regularly inspect the gauge, tighten fittings, and keep the plastic housing free of dust and moisture. Follow manufacturer-recommended cleaning and inspection routines and replace worn seals or gaskets promptly. Verify the unit remains compatible with your pump and piping sizes as your system evolves.
